How much do insurance accounting j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for insurance accounting in Colorado is $100,587.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$82,000.00 and $117,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Insurance Accounting position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Insurance Accounting, a solid understanding of accounting principles, insurance regulations, and financial analysis is essential, often supported by a degree in accounting or finance. Proficiency with accounting software (such as QuickBooks or SAP), spreadsheet tools, and knowledge of industry-specific systems or certifications (like CPA) is highly valued. Attention to detail, strong analytical thinking, and effective communication are important soft skills for this position. These competencies enable accurate financial reporting, regulatory compliance, and seamless collaboration with other departments, which are critical for success in the insurance sector.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of someone working in Insurance Accounting?

Professionals in Insurance Accounting are responsible for processing policyholder premiums, managing claims payments, reconciling accounts, and preparing financial statements specific to insurance operations. They also monitor compliance with state and federal insurance regulations, assist with audits, and may support financial forecasting for underwriting decisions. Much of the role involves cross-functional collaboration with claims teams, underwriters, and compliance staff. On a typical day, you can expect to spend time using specialized accounting software, reviewing financial transactions for accuracy, and ensuring all reporting deadlines are met.

What is an Insurance Accounting job?

An Insurance Accounting job involves managing the financial records and transactions of an insurance company, ensuring compliance with industry regulations and accounting standards. Professionals in this role handle premium revenues, claims payments, reserves, and financial reporting. They analyze financial data to assess profitability, prepare statements, and collaborate with auditors and regulators. Strong knowledge of insurance regulations, financial analysis, and accounting principles is essential for this role.
